Description

1,3-Dimethyl-5-(Thiophen-2-Ylmethylene)Pyrimidine-2,4,6(1H,3H,5H)-Trione is a specialized heterocyclic organic compound featuring a fused pyrimidine-trione core substituted with a thiophene moiety. This unique molecular architecture makes it a valuable advanced intermediate or building block in sophisticated chemical synthesis. It is primarily sought after by pharmaceutical research and fine chemical industries for the development of novel active ingredients and functional materials.

Basic Information

Product Name 1,3-Dimethyl-5-(Thiophen-2-Ylmethylene)Pyrimidine-2,4,6(1H,3H,5H)-Trione
CAS No. 198276-19-6
Molecular Formula C11H10N2O3S
Molecular Weight 250.27 g/mol
Synonyms 5-[(Thiophen-2-yl)methylene]-1,3-dimethylpyrimidine-2,4,6(1H,3H,5H)-trione; 1,3-Dimethyl-5-(2-thienylmethylene)barbituric acid; Thiophene-2-carbaldehyde, condensation product with 1,3-dimethylbarbituric acid; DMTPT; Contact for additional synonyms.
